As aircraft systems continue to shift toward digital avionics architectures, maintenance teams are under increasing pressure to access and interpret onboard data quickly and accurately. Vitrek's MTI Instruments solutions are addressing this need with ARINC 429 and ARINC 664 (AFDX) integration in its PBS-4100 and PBS-4100R engine vibration balancing systems, enabling direct access to critical engine parameters during maintenance procedures.
By eliminating the need for multiple analog connections, technicians can now retrieve engine speed and vibration data directly from the aircraft’s data network. This significantly reduces setup complexity and accelerates diagnostics, allowing MRO teams to perform trim balancing more efficiently while maintaining the precision required for accurate vibration analysis.
For airlines and service providers operating under tight turnaround schedules, these capabilities translate into faster maintenance cycles, reduced downtime, and improved operational efficiency. As digital aircraft platforms become the norm, tools like the PBS-4100 are helping maintenance teams keep pace with evolving avionics systems while optimizing performance on the ground.
